Essential Functions shall include but are not limited to;

  • Attend all ASG/Bellevue College/Student Programs training sessions and meetings, including but not limited to the Camp Casey Leadership Retreat, summer and quarterly retreats.
  • Serve on all assigned committees
  • Develop a working knowledge of, and abide by the ASBC Constitution, ASBC By-Laws, ASBC Ethics Code, and ASBC Financial Code
  • Finance related duties:

Monitor ASBC club and program budget appropriations and expenditures

Chair Service and Activity Fee Budget Committee

Create, manage, and oversee budget monitoring systems

Assist President in budget management, strategic direction, and analysis

Assist clubs, programs, and students in ASG funding requests process

Provide weekly reports to the ASG Executive Branch on S&A budget status

Serve as liaison between ASG and Student Programs Budget Director and Student Programs Budget Authority

Work collaboratively with BC Foundation on fundraising opportunities for student clubs and programs

Chair the Student Senate’s Budget Allocation Committee (pending approval)
